What are the Techniques for Restoring Old Photographs Digitally?

Techniques for restoring old photographs digitally include scanning, image editing, color correction, and noise reduction. Scanning involves creating a high-resolution digital copy of the photograph, which serves as the foundation for further restoration. Image editing software, such as Adobe Photoshop, allows for the removal of scratches, dust, and other imperfections through tools like the healing brush and clone stamp. Color correction techniques adjust faded colors to their original vibrancy, often using levels and curves adjustments. Noise reduction methods help eliminate graininess and enhance overall image clarity. These techniques are widely used by professionals and hobbyists alike to preserve historical images and improve their visual quality.

How do digital restoration techniques differ from traditional methods?

Digital restoration techniques utilize software tools to enhance and repair images, while traditional methods rely on physical processes such as manual retouching and chemical treatments. Digital methods allow for non-destructive editing, enabling restorers to work on high-resolution scans without altering the original photograph, which contrasts with traditional techniques that can permanently change the physical medium. Additionally, digital restoration can incorporate advanced algorithms for noise reduction and color correction, providing more precise results than manual methods, which are often limited by the skill and experience of the restorer. This distinction is evident in the efficiency and flexibility of digital tools, which can quickly apply consistent corrections across multiple images, a process that is labor-intensive and time-consuming in traditional restoration.

What software is commonly used in digital photo restoration?

Adobe Photoshop is commonly used in digital photo restoration. This software provides a wide range of tools and features specifically designed for retouching and repairing images, such as the Healing Brush, Clone Stamp, and various filters. Additionally, GIMP (GNU Image Manipulation Program) is another popular choice, offering similar functionalities as Photoshop but as a free and open-source alternative. Both software options are widely recognized in the field for their effectiveness in restoring old photographs, making them essential tools for professionals and enthusiasts alike.

What are the common challenges faced in digital photo restoration?

Common challenges faced in digital photo restoration include dealing with image degradation, color correction, and maintaining authenticity. Image degradation often results from physical damage like tears, fading, or discoloration, making it difficult to restore the original quality. Color correction is challenging due to the varying degrees of fading and color shifts that occur over time, requiring precise adjustments to achieve a natural look. Additionally, maintaining authenticity is crucial; restorers must balance enhancements with the original character of the photograph to avoid over-processing, which can lead to a loss of historical value. These challenges necessitate a combination of technical skills and artistic judgment to achieve successful restorations.

What are the Steps Involved in Digitally Restoring Old Photographs?

The steps involved in digitally restoring old photographs include scanning the image, cleaning the digital file, correcting color and exposure, removing blemishes and scratches, and finally saving the restored image in a suitable format.

Initially, scanning the photograph at a high resolution captures all details, which is crucial for effective restoration. Next, cleaning the digital file involves using software tools to remove dust and dirt that may have been introduced during the scanning process. After that, correcting color and exposure ensures that the image reflects its original appearance, often requiring adjustments to brightness, contrast, and saturation.

The subsequent step is to remove blemishes and scratches using cloning or healing tools available in photo editing software, which helps to restore the image to its former glory. Finally, saving the restored image in formats like TIFF or PNG preserves the quality and allows for future edits if necessary. Each of these steps is essential for achieving a high-quality digital restoration of old photographs.

How do you prepare a photograph for digital restoration?

To prepare a photograph for digital restoration, first, ensure the physical photograph is clean and free from dust or debris. This involves using a soft brush or a microfiber cloth to gently remove any particles without damaging the surface. Next, scan the photograph at a high resolution, typically at least 300 DPI, to capture all details and nuances. This high-quality scan serves as the foundation for digital restoration, allowing for precise editing and enhancement. Additionally, save the scanned image in a lossless format, such as TIFF, to preserve the quality during the restoration process. These steps are essential as they provide a clear and detailed digital representation of the original photograph, facilitating effective restoration techniques.

What scanning techniques yield the best results for old photographs?

The scanning techniques that yield the best results for old photographs include flatbed scanning and high-resolution drum scanning. Flatbed scanners provide a good balance of quality and accessibility, allowing for detailed captures of images without damaging the originals. High-resolution drum scanners, while more expensive and less accessible, offer superior image quality by using a rotating drum to achieve higher optical resolutions, which is particularly beneficial for capturing fine details and textures in old photographs. Studies have shown that scanning at a minimum of 300 DPI (dots per inch) is essential for preserving detail, while 600 DPI or higher is recommended for archival purposes, ensuring that the nuances of the original photograph are accurately represented in the digital format.

How do you perform color correction and enhancement?

To perform color correction and enhancement, utilize software tools like Adobe Photoshop or Lightroom to adjust color balance, saturation, and contrast. Begin by assessing the image for color casts, then apply adjustments using the color balance tool to correct any unwanted hues. Increase saturation to enhance colors, ensuring not to overdo it to maintain natural appearance. Finally, adjust contrast to improve the overall depth of the image, making sure to check the histogram for balanced exposure. These methods are standard practices in digital photo restoration, supported by industry guidelines for effective image enhancement.

What methods are used for image retouching and reconstruction?

Image retouching and reconstruction utilize methods such as cloning, healing, and content-aware fill. Cloning involves duplicating parts of an image to cover imperfections, while healing blends the surrounding pixels to create a seamless repair. Content-aware fill intelligently analyzes the image to fill in gaps based on surrounding content, making it particularly effective for removing unwanted objects. These methods are widely used in digital photography and graphic design to enhance and restore images, ensuring a polished final product.

What Best Practices Should Be Followed in Digital Photo Restoration?

The best practices in digital photo restoration include using high-resolution scans, employing non-destructive editing techniques, and maintaining color accuracy. High-resolution scans capture more detail, allowing for better restoration outcomes. Non-destructive editing techniques, such as using layers in software like Adobe Photoshop, enable restorers to make adjustments without permanently altering the original image. Maintaining color accuracy is crucial, as it ensures that the restored photo reflects the original’s true colors, which can be achieved by using calibrated monitors and color profiles. These practices are supported by industry standards in digital imaging, which emphasize the importance of detail, flexibility, and authenticity in restoration work.
